Abstract
Er3+-doped transparent oxyfluoride borosilicate glass ceramics containing LaOF nanocrystals have been obtained by the high temperature melt-quenching and subsequent heat treatment method. The formation of LaOF nanocrystals in the glass matrix was confirmed by XRD and TEM results. In comparison with the precursor glass, Er3+-doped transparent oxyfluoride glass ceramics containing LaOF nanocrystals exhibited efficient up-conversion luminescence. Especially, the green emission intensity was greatly enhanced about nearly 200 times and its up-conversion mechanism can be ascribed to a two-photon absorption process.
